Kruskal Wallis Test

Formula:

$H =\bigg(\dfrac{12}{N(N+1)}\sum_{j=1}^k \dfrac{R_j^2}{n_j} \bigg)-3(N+1)$

where

  • $k$ is the number of comparison groups
  • $N$ is the total sample size
  • $n_j$ is the sample size in the $j^{th}$ group
  • $R_j$ is the sum of the ranks in the $j^{th}$ group
